HEADLINE: YOKO,70, AIMS FOR TOP 20 

YOKO ONO could score her biggest UK hit single more than 20 years after the death of her husband, ex- Beatle John Lennon. 

Now 70, Yoko, left, has joined forces with The Pet Shop Boys to record a new dance version of her great song Walking On Thin Ice. The original only reached No35 in 1981. Thanks to Neil Tennant and Chris Lowe, the new version is tipped for the top 20. 

In 1987, they duetted with Dusty Springfield on What Have I Done To Deserve This which hit No2. 

An insider said: "Neil and Chris kept saying why doesn't somebody cover Walking On Thin Ice?' In the end they decided to do it themselves with Yoko." 

Her success could leave arch-rival Paul McCartney gnashing his teeth. He hasn't had a UK top 10 single since 1987.
